Prototype Development Of Information System Customer Relationship Management Web-Based Aesthetic Beauty Clinics

Sutono Sutono, Halimah Halimah, Ochi Marshella Febriani

Abstract


Every company will definitely develop innovations that are always the latest in order to provide comfort in service to customers. Good service quality must be managed professionally, especially in managing information related to the customer. One of the means to accommodate customer data management is to develop a Customer Relationship Management (CRM) information system on Kartika Aesthetic that operates in the field of beauty clinics. As in general, customers who will take care must come directly to Kartika Aesthetic for registration. Not only that, notification of the customer's routine check schedule is also done when the customer finishes doing maintenance. Therefore, many customers forget the check date again because there is no notification or reminder about it. Notifications regarding discounts or treatment promo prices are also notified using social media Instagram and Facebook, if the customer does not have an account, then the customer does not get information about the ongoing promo or discount. With the existence of this CRM information system, it is expected to be able to help the acquisition of information needed by customers to be easy and fast in accordance with the expectations and needs of customers and to bridge the communication between Kartika Aesthetic and customers. The purpose of this research is to develop a prototype CRM information system, to test and evaluate the CRM information system that has been designed. The programming languages used in this system are Java and MySQL databases. The method for developing this information system uses the Relational Unified Process method with UML tools (use case diagrams, activity diagrams, class diagrams and Sequence diagrams). This CRM information system is designed with attention to user needs. In addition to making it easy for customers to register directly through the Prototype information system, this CRM information system enables customers to obtain information about maintenance schedules, new types of treatments and other promos easily and in accordance with and the need sof the customers.
